Einführung in Backstage
Schulung & Kurs

Ein Tag intensiver Einstieg in die Implementierung von Developer Portal mit ausgewählten Elementen von Backstage (z.B. Kubernetes, docs-as-code, Plugins, Kosten Transparenz).

Unternehmensanwendungen werden immer verteilter, unteranderem durch den Einsatz von Microservice Architekturen. Dabei den Überblick über die IT Landschaft zu waren ist einer der zentrallen Herausforderungen eines Unternehmens. Backstage löst diese Herausforderung mit einem dezentralen Ansatz, bei welchem die Entwicklungsteams die Daten zur IT Landschaft bereit stellen und so zentral ein Single-Pane-of-Glass entstehen kann.

Kurse für Teams:

Gerne führen wir zugeschnittene Kurse für euer Team durch - vor Ort, remote oder in unseren Kursräumen.

In-House Kurs Anfragen

 

Kursinhalt:


Wir bauen zusammen ein Developer Portal, welche folgende Themen veranschaulicht:

- Einführung Developer Portal
- Backstage Core Features
- Software Catalog
- Software Templates
- TechDocs (docs-as-code)
- Integration
- Kubernetes
- Authentication und Identity
- Backstage erweitern
- Community Plugins
- Custom Plugins
- Platform Engineering

Wir fokussieren uns darauf, eine spezifische Auswahl an Themen genau zu betrachten und zu verstehen.


Disclaimer: Der effektive Kursinhalt kann, abhängig vom Trainer, Durchführung, Dauer und Konstellation der Teilnehmer:innen von obigen Angaben abweichen.

Ob wir es Schulung, Kurs, Workshop, Seminar oder Training nennen, wir möchten Teilnehmer/innen an ihrem Punkt abholen und mit dem nötigen praktischen Wissen ausstatten, damit sie die Technologie nach der Schulung direkt anwenden und eigenständig vertiefen können.

Ziel:

Aufbau von praktischem Know-How und Schaffung eines umfassenden Verständnis zur effizienten Verwendung des Backstage Ecosystems.
Die Teilnehmenden können am Ende eigenständig Backstage aufsetzten / konfigurieren / erweitern und verstehen die Konzepte eines Developer Portals.


Dauer:

1 Tag (Wird bei In-House Kursen individuell angepasst.)


Form:

Bewährter Mix aus Erläuterung, Live-Coding und gemeinsamem Aufbau von Backstage mit praktischem Fokus.


Zielgruppe:

Softwareentwickler oder Platform Teams, die einen effizienten Start in die Verwendung von Backstage erhalten und erste Anwendungsfälle damit unsetzten wollen.


Voraussetzungen:

Basiswissen in der Entwicklung mit Node.js und React.


Vorbereitung:

Jeder Teilnehmer erhält nach der Anmeldung einen Fragebogen und eine Installationsanleitung zugestellt. Abhängig vom Kurs stellen wir eine passende Laborumgebung bereit.

In-House Kurs anfragen:

In-House Kurs Anfragen

Trage dich in die Warteliste ein für weitere öffentliche Kurs-Termine. Sobald wir genügend Personen auf der Warteliste haben, klären wir einen möglichst für alle passenden Termin ab und schalten einen neuen Termin auf. Falls du direkt mit zwei Kollegen oder Kolleginnen teilnehmen möchtest, können wir sogar direkt einen öffentlichen Kurs für euch planen.

Warteliste

(Falls ihr bereits mehr 3 Teilnehmer:innen oder mehr habt, klären wir mit euch direkt euren Wunschtermin ab und schreiben den Kurs aus.)

Mehr über Backstage



Backstage ist ein Open-Source-Framework von Spotify zum Aufbau interner Developer Portals und hat sich zur führenden Lösung für Platform Engineering in grossen Organisationen entwickelt. Mit seinem dezentralen Ansatz ermöglicht Backstage Entwicklungsteams, ihre Services, Dokumentation und Infrastruktur in einem einheitlichen Software Catalog zu verwalten – dem Single Pane of Glass für die gesamte IT-Landschaft. Dank eines umfangreichen Plugin-Ökosystems und der aktiven CNCF-Community lässt sich Backstage flexibel an individuelle Unternehmensanforderungen anpassen.




History


Backstage wurde intern bei Spotify entwickelt, um die wachsende Komplexität einer Microservice-Architektur mit Tausenden von Services beherrschbar zu machen. Nach der Open-Source-Veröffentlichung im Jahr 2020 wuchs die Community rasant: Backstage wurde 2022 als Incubating-Projekt in die Cloud Native Computing Foundation (CNCF) aufgenommen und erreichte 2023 den Status eines graduated CNCF-Projekts. Heute zählt Backstage weltweit über 3000 Adopter, darunter namhafte Unternehmen wie LinkedIn, Siemens, Vodafone und American Airlines.


Mit der wachsenden Bedeutung von Platform Engineering als Disziplin hat sich Backstage als zentrales Werkzeug etabliert, um Developer Experience zu verbessern und Self-Service-Fähigkeiten für Entwicklungsteams bereitzustellen. Managed-Service-Anbieter wie Roadie ermöglichen Unternehmen die Nutzung von Backstage ohne eigenen Betriebsaufwand, während die CNCF 2024 mit dem Certified Backstage Associate die erste offizielle Zertifizierung für das Framework eingeführt hat.